Select n/72-inch Line Spacing (n dots)

Sets the line spacing to n/72 of an inch, for subsequent lines. A spacing
of 1/72 inch (1 point in font size) is the distance between pins on the
printhead (approximately 1 dot) and 9/72 is 8 lines per inch. Range of n
is 0-85.
Format
Decimal
27 59 n

Set Right Margin

Clears all text in the print buffer and sets the right margin to n columns,
using the current character pitch. This is the number of the characters
from column 1 (at the left edge of the paper) to the last column before
the right margin (factory default = 80).
Minimum space between margins is the width of one double-width pica
character. Maximum value for this is the maximum number of characters
(based on the current pitch) that would fit between the left margin and
the right edge of the default printable area of the page. Ranges shown
below could vary, depending on values of other parameters that affect
character width. If the value specified is not within the allowed range, it
is ignored.
Range of n is 2-80 in Pica mode, 2-96 in Elite mode, and 2-136 in
compressed mode.
Format
Decimal
27 81 n

Set Left Margin

Clears the print buffer text and sets the left margin, relative to the
number of columns to the left of the first column to print
(factory default = 0).
